You will lead the award winning team providing a 24 hour service and comprising of Forensic Physicians, Crisis Workers, SARC Delivery Manager and SARC Operational Manager. In addition complainants are supported by a team of adult and child Independent Sexual Violence Advisers (ISVAs) including one who specialises in supporting complainants with complex needs.
Using your leadership skills and expertise, you will take responsibility for the delivery of safe and effective clinical services ensuring all targets, performance standards, deadlines and objectives are met.
The Clinical Lead identified requirements in FFLM Quality Standards GFM & SoM
Must attend an initial accredited training courses such as the FFLM/University of Teesside one-week course in GFM and/or SOM (adult and paediatrics), before commencing unsupervised clinical work;
Obtain the FFLM Licentiate qualification- Within three years or the FFLM Membership qualification- within five years
Should complete training in statement writing and courtroom skills
Attended a FFLM approved one day Best Practice SARC/GFM day-Within 3 years.
Previously conducted SARC Forensic Medical Examinations-Peer Review of 3 from last 12 months.
NHFT is an integrated primary care and mental health Trust, providing physical, mental health and specialty services in both hospital settings and out in the community. Because we put the person at the centre of all we do, we focus on delivering care that is as easy to access as possible. This means many of our services can be provided at home, work or in schools. We also provide health services to various prisons and detention centres in Bedfordshire and Cambridgeshire.
NHFT promotes a culture of learning to improve the care and safety of our patients and staff, which focuses on people who enable our Trust to be ‘outstanding’ by supporting opportunity, innovation, development and growth.
